Output e356294b86ad666a69777cfa5032b60ecda4d454ffb86aaf7653a9cca305c658:0

value
3788244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dda1905da89ef48bc323c9fdc5fc4fc3539f036 OP_EQUAL
address
34QrnoaSTHDLwrxABtRDdKFg4haoWttpYH
transaction
e356294b86ad666a69777cfa5032b60ecda4d454ffb86aaf7653a9cca305c658
spent
true